Output efbe42b85feffd9c056649bc0737d19cf72055ceebcb92960623694ab2e1845a:4

value
3607080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ba6bf1a8eed6dfdecb7516e10d24b9f0c92da18 OP_EQUAL
address
3MiRfJcWx6UXMeorm1cSm3QuSZ2MkcBNM7
transaction
efbe42b85feffd9c056649bc0737d19cf72055ceebcb92960623694ab2e1845a
confirmations
253279
spent
true